Open Pie with Oyster Mushrooms Recipe
Dear cooks, I want to offer you a recipe for an open pie with oyster mushrooms and cream filling. The pie turns out to be hearty, tasty and fragrant!! The pie dough is used very interesting, without eggs and butter, so it is quite suitable for lean baking!!

Instructions
  1. In a bowl, pour 250 g of flour, add 1/2 tsp salt and 1 tsp baking powder, mix. Pour in the olive oil and, gradually adding hot (not boiling) water, knead the dough first with a spoon, then with your hands.
  2. The dough should be very soft and elastic, it should not stick to your hands. The dough is wrapped in plastic wrap and sent to the refrigerator for 1 hour.
  3. While we are preparing the filling. We cut the mushrooms in any way convenient for you, I cut them into strips. And we send it to a preheated frying pan to fry (I did not add oil). Fry the mushrooms under the lid over medium heat until the liquid has completely evaporated. At the end, add salt and freshly ground pepper.
  4. In a bowl, mix 2 eggs with a pinch of salt, add 150 ml of cream and 100 g of cottage cheese. Beat with a whisk until smooth.
  5. Take the dough out of the refrigerator. Roll it out into a layer larger than the diameter of the baking dish (removable 26 cm), and transfer it to a greased mold. Form the sides of the future pie. The dough turns out to be very elastic, it is absolutely easy to shift it into a mold.
  6. Mushrooms are divided according to the principle. Spread the filling evenly on top.
  7. Grate 100 g of hard cheese (according to your taste) on a coarse grater and put it on top of the filling.
  8. Send the pie to bake in a preheated 180 degree oven for 50 minutes. You can cover the mold with foil on top so that the cheese is not fried too much.
